Camel Milk for Bone Health: Calcium and Beyond
There is a prevalent myth that only cow's milk can effectively support bone health due to its high calcium content. However, camel milk is emerging as a formidable contender in the realm of dairy nutrition, particularly for skeletal well-being. Studies suggest that camel milk not only contains calcium but also offers unique bioactive compounds that could enhance bone density and strength. This article aims to debunk the misconception that cow's milk is the sole source of essential nutrients for bone health.
Camel milk contains a significant amount of calcium, which is crucial for maintaining bone structure and function. The bioavailability of calcium in camel milk is often considered superior due to its unique protein composition and lower casein content compared to cow's milk. This can facilitate better absorption in the gastrointestinal tract, potentially leading to improved calcium utilization in the body. Thus, camel milk serves as an excellent alternative for those looking to enhance their calcium intake.
Beyond calcium, camel milk is rich in other essential nutrients that contribute to bone health. It contains magnesium, phosphorus, and vitamins such as vitamin D, which play vital roles in calcium metabolism and bone mineralization. Magnesium, for instance, is integral to the formation of bone, while phosphorus works closely with calcium to build and maintain bone structure. The combination of these nutrients in camel milk may offer a synergistic effect, promoting overall skeletal health.
Research indicates that camel milk may also possess anti-inflammatory properties, which can be beneficial for bone health. Chronic inflammation is known to contribute to bone loss and conditions such as osteoporosis. The presence of bioactive peptides in camel milk could help modulate inflammatory responses, thereby protecting bone tissue from degradation. This potential anti-inflammatory effect adds another layer of benefit to the consumption of camel milk for individuals concerned about their bone health.
Furthermore, the unique lipid composition of camel milk may enhance its nutritional profile. Camel milk contains medium-chain fatty acids, which are known to have various health benefits, including improved metabolic functions. These fatty acids might also influence calcium absorption and retention in the bones. Therefore, the lipid content of camel milk could play a role in its effectiveness as a bone health promoter.
The fermentation of camel milk can also modify its nutritional properties, resulting in the formation of bioactive compounds that may further support bone health. Fermented camel milk products have been shown to contain higher levels of probiotics, which can aid in gut health and enhance nutrient absorption. A healthy gut microbiome is crucial for optimal nutrient uptake, including calcium and other bone-supporting minerals. Thus, fermented camel milk could offer additional advantages over its non-fermented counterparts.
While the evidence surrounding camel milk and bone health is promising, it is essential to approach these findings with a balanced perspective. Much of the existing research is preliminary, and further studies are required to establish definitive conclusions regarding the long-term effects of camel milk on bone density and health. Nevertheless, the unique composition of camel milk positions it as a noteworthy dietary option for individuals looking to support their bone health through nutritional means.
